Post by Peter BesenbruchJerome lived in the 4th and early 5th centuries. While Rome was in
decline, it was hardly a village during his life. He actually lived
in Rome during the early 380s. He found the city not suitable to
his ascetic lifestyle. I believe he referred to it as "Babylon."

Post by Peter BesenbruchThe original poster makes a few more mistakes. The tribes invading in the
4th century were not the ones that founded the more modern states in
Europe. While the tribes were not stupid, and realized Rome was getting
weaker, they also admired it for what it once was. Some of that admiration
rubbed off on the church, both east and west.

Short Biography of Keith Hunt
Keith Hunt was born in South Wales. When he was 5, his family moved
to Yorkshire, England, where he was educated in a Church of England school
until the age of 17. The first half hour of each school day was spent in
the Bible, reading and memorizing various part of both the Old and New
Testament. Keith was also a faithful Sunday school attender in his local
church during those early years of his life. He believed and was taught to
memorize the Ten Commandments as found in Exodus 20. He believed Sunday
was the 7th day of the week, as none of his teachers in school or in
church had told him differently.
He came to Canada at the age of 18. It was not long before he came
into contact with what was then known as the Radio Church of God, later
known as the Worldwide Church of God, and began listening to their radio
broadcast. He was attending a Baptist church, and it was his Baptist
landlord that first told him Sunday was not the 7th but 1st day of the
week. This was a total shock to Keith, who then spent many hours in the
Public Library proving such was indeed the case.
Shortly after learning this fact, he discovered the Radio Church of
God taught 7th day Sabbath keeping. Soon thereafter, he became a member,
and was later baptized by them.
Many of the doctrines being taught by the Radio Church of God at
that time were quite acceptable to Keith, as he already believed them from
his years of Bible reading and study. He came up through the ranks, being
a leading member of his local church, even being trained under the
church's system for the ministry. But as time went on, many problems
developed in what was then known as the Worldwide Church of God. Thousands
of members and dozens of ministers left that organization during the 70's.
Keith was one of them.
